Company overview

The State Street Fixed Income Sector Rotation ETF endeavors to deliver superior returns by employing an active investment strategy. It dynamically allocates capital among various income and yield-producing exchange-traded funds (ETFs), guided by a proprietary analytical framework that combines data-driven quantitative methods with expert qualitative assessments. The fund primarily directs its investments into ETFs specializing in a diverse range of fixed income sectors. These encompass, among others, U.S. government and agency debt, Treasury Inflation-Protected Securities (TIPS), corporate bonds, mortgage-backed securities, high-yield debt, international government and corporate bonds (including those from emerging markets), senior loans, floating rate notes, and cash equivalents. A core investment policy mandates that at least 80% of the fund's net assets are invested in fixed income instruments via ETFs. While the portfolio is generally rebalanced on a monthly basis, the frequency of these adjustments can vary depending on prevailing market dynamics.
